“Customer Certified” vs. Organic
There are several issues that we see with the organic certification process. The process is very expensive and very time consuming, becoming another difficult extra layer of regulation that makes it hard for small scale agriculture to compete.
In many cases "organic" has become another label to sell a product. There are many certified organic approaches that make us just as uncomfortable as applying chemicals. These issues leave us with the realization that the organic certification is not the right approach for us.
Our idea of healthy, safe food is built upon the foundational belief that the closer our food gets to its natural state, the better it is for us. We embrace this natural approach and hold our practices and improvements up to this standard. We eliminate the harmful uses of chemicals, antibiotics, hormones, and unnatural feeds.
If we were marketing outside of our local area, "certified organic" may be the best guarantee that we could offer. Since we are not marketing outside our local area, we feel that having a relationship with our customers is a better guarantee. We believe in the "know your farmer, know you food" concept. Our "customer certified" approach keeps us personally involved in the marketing process. Through CSA, farmers markets, and our own networking, we are able to maintain a connection with our customers.
The best guarantee we can offer our customers is involvement in the process. We call it “customer certification” in which the farm doors are open to our customers and they certify if the operations meet their standards. We view every person that visits our operation as an inspector. Our commitment to our customers is fresh, quality, safe produce.
